Barcelona Dominates Real Madrid
Barcelona secured their 15th Spanish Super Cup title with a stunning 5-2 victory over Real Madrid on January 12, 2025, in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ia. The win extended Barcelona’s lead over Real Madrid, who have won the trophy 13 times.

A Dramatic Start
The match began on a dramatic note as Kylian Mbappé gave Real Madrid an early lead in the fifth minute. Barcelona, however, wasted no time in responding. Lamine Yamal, the 17-year-old sensation, equalized in the 22nd minute, showcasing his incredible talent.

Robert Lewandowski then converted a penalty to put Barcelona ahead. Raphinha followed up with two quick goals before halftime, and Alejandro Balde added another to make it 4-1 by the break.
Second-Half Highlights
In the second half, Raphinha struck again, completing his hat trick and extending the lead to 5-1. Barcelona’s dominance, however, faced a challenge when Wojciech Szczesny received a red card for fouling Mbappé. Reduced to ten players, Barcelona held firm despite Real Madrid’s attempts to capitalize. Rodrygo managed to score a consolation goal from a free-kick, bringing the final score to 5-2.
Real Madrid Fans React
Early Exits
As Barcelona’s lead grew insurmountable, many Real Madrid fans began leaving the stadium before the match concluded. Their early departure reflected mounting frustration with the team’s performance.

Audible Displeasure
Fans who stayed voiced their discontent with boos and jeers, especially during defensive errors. The lackluster performance in such a high-stakes game against their rivals drew sharp criticism.
Emotional Toll
Expressions of disbelief and disappointment were visible among the remaining fans. The crushing defeat took an emotional toll, as many struggled to process the team’s shortcomings on such a significant stage.
Social Media Reactions
Beyond the stadium, fans turned to social media to air their grievances. Criticism of tactics, player performances, and calls for changes dominated the conversation, highlighting the widespread dissatisfaction among Real Madrid supporters.
Barcelona’s emphatic win not only underscored their current dominance but also left Real Madrid grappling with tough questions about their future strategy and team dynamics.
